om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 10:39 am

Bonjour à tous, je débute en Framboise314, je viens de craquer pour le ptit joujou. Mon objectif dans un premier temps est d'en faire un MediaCenter pour la chambre (divx et mp3).
Il est à peine sollicité et pourtant CPU toujours à 100%, il rame grave... genre le curseur pas fluide du tout et il met vraiment longtemps pour ouvrir un répertoire ou une playlist m3u qui contient 300 chansons.

La config:
Raspberry PI B avec 512 de ram
openelec 3.2.4 installé avec l'option fichiers systèmes sur clé USB (tuto sur pcinpact)
fichiers avi et mp3 sur disque NAS
écran connecté en hdmi/dvi

une fois ça a été fluide je ne sais pour quelle raison et depuis plus rien, la rame complète...

J'ai cru voir un jour un soucis lié à l'affichage hdmi/dvi avec genre une option à sélectionner au démarrage mais je ne trouve rien de + comme info à ce sujet, est ce quelqu'un a une idée ou des conseils pour m'aider à avancer ?

Un grand merci à la communauté pour ces forums d'un grand secours ! et un autre merci d'avance au cas où un passionné compétent voudra participer à mon aventure !

A+, omR.

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 2:41 pm

Même soucis avec une install "standard" de openelec 3.0.6 sans faire la bidouille avec la clé USB, donc ça ne vient pas de là.
J'ai aussi une souris sans fil mais quand je la débranche le processeur reste à 97-100%, donc pas ça non plus...
pour info supplémentaire:
Processeur ARMv6-compatible proc rev7 (v6l)
Bogomips:697.95
Hardware: BCM2708
Révision 000e

la température du proc est à 60°c max rien d'alarmant
J'ai bien une carte SD 4Go classe 4.

Si ça peut aider à comprendre...

totoharibo
Posts: 4446
Joined: Thu Jan 24, 2013 8:43 am

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 3:20 pm

et si tu le laisses en route une journée complète c'est pareil ?

AMHA : Il faut qu'il mette à jour sa base de données et ton NAS ne doit pas faire 100M mais un peu plus :-)

jeanluc
Posts: 312
Joined: Thu Apr 11, 2013 9:44 am

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 3:39 pm

Bonjour;
Teste avec raspbmc.

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 3:55 pm

yep merci bien de la réponse totoharibo. jeanluc pour raspbmc je testerai effectivement si pas de solution efficace mais quand même c'est sensé marcher ct'histoire là !!

C 'est bien ce qui me semblait mais comment voir l'activité de mise à jour d'une base de données ? y'a un moniteur d'activité détaillé, plus développé que juste l'activité CPU et utilisation RAM ? avec Putty ?
et quand je lui dis d'ajouter un répertoire à la bib multimédia je vois bien une barre de progression (genre 2h pour màj 60Go de mp3) mais ensuite c la même merde pour ouvrir ce répertoire, il lui faut 30 secondes pour afficher le contenu... mais bon ça je soupçonne que ce soit lié au fait que le proc est à 100% sur autre chose. Pareil pour ouvrir un fichier m3u, il le ré-étudie à chaque fois et ça prend des plombes...

Le NAS fait 1To mais "seulement" 140Go d'occupés (on vit une époque formidable, fini le MAC+ dernier cri avec 20Mo de disque dur !).

Au passage, une aberration que j'imagine contournable mais quand même... pas moyen de changer le son quand je lis de la musique, l'idéal serait avec la molette, tu connais un moyen ? une interface ?

A+ et merci encore, omR.

JumpZero
Posts: 1131
Joined: Thu Mar 28, 2013 7:35 pm
Location: 127.0.0.1

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 4:06 pm

Bjr,
y'a un moniteur d'activité détaillé, plus développé que juste l'activité CPU et utilisation RAM ? avec Putty ?
utilises top
et pour la doc de la commande top tu tapes "man top"
--
Jmp0

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 5:07 pm

Merci Jump0 mais je ne suis que sous Windaube..., j'ai galéré pour trouver quelques infos sur top et ça a l'air pour linux uniquement non ?
et je vais pas me faire une formation complète juste pour connaître l'activité de mon rasp !

à suivre...

totoharibo
Posts: 4446
Joined: Thu Jan 24, 2013 8:43 am

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 6:30 pm

le marketting windows est passé par là : ll ne faut pas en faire un monde du "monde console"

Une connexion ssh par putty c'est tout à fait ce qu'il faut.

suis le conseil de JumpZero (man top)

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 7:47 pm

ok merci bien, j'ai lu la page man.cx, vous me suggérez d'apprendre tout le langage et sa grammaire c'ets bien ça ?
Putty est en place, par contre comprendre quelle ligne taper pour avoir une liste des taches en cours c'est une autre paire de manche.
Jusqu'ici les réponses m'ont malheureusement pas trop fait avancer, tout ça je m'y mets petit à petit, Linux et son univers... il me faut du coup de pouce pour pas m’écœurer d'entrée de jeu.

Donc imaginez que je suis physiquement intelligente, l'air un peu naïve et que je ne sais pas où dormir ce soir, je n'ai qu'une seule requête dans l'immédiat, simple: quelle ligne de commande taper dans putty après m'être logger (ça je sais faire !) pour faire apparaître une liste des taches en cours sur mon Raspberry ? et ainsi comprendre pourquoi mon curseur avance à 4 pixels/minute ??!

La bonne soirée à tous et à très vite ! ;)
omR.


Phill Rymer
Posts: 207
Joined: Sun Nov 04, 2012 3:01 am

Re: CPU à 100% en permanence avec seulement XBMC de base...

Sun Jan 19, 2014 11:16 pm

omrlepsykotist wrote:Bonjour à tous, je débute en Framboise314, je viens de craquer pour le ptit joujou. Mon objectif dans un premier temps est d'en faire un MediaCenter pour la chambre (divx et mp3).
Il est à peine sollicité et pourtant CPU toujours à 100%, il rame grave... genre le curseur pas fluide du tout et il met vraiment longtemps pour ouvrir un répertoire ou une playlist m3u qui contient 300 chansons.

La config:
Raspberry PI B avec 512 de ram
openelec 3.2.4 installé avec l'option fichiers systèmes sur clé USB (tuto sur pcinpact)
fichiers avi et mp3 sur disque NAS
écran connecté en hdmi/dvi

une fois ça a été fluide je ne sais pour quelle raison et depuis plus rien, la rame complète...
disable rss feedmakes it smoother

J'ai cru voir un jour un soucis lié à l'affichage hdmi/dvi avec genre une option à sélectionner au démarrage mais je ne trouve rien de + comme info à ce sujet, est ce quelqu'un a une idée ou des conseils pour m'aider à avancer ?

Un grand merci à la communauté pour ces forums d'un grand secours ! et un autre merci d'avance au cas où un passionné compétent voudra participer à mon aventure !

A+, omR.

totoharibo
Posts: 4446
Joined: Thu Jan 24, 2013 8:43 am

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 9:26 am

Avant tout débranche ton disque dur et redémarre pour voir si ça rame toujours.

Je l'ai essayé aussi mais ça ramait comme Oxford-Cambridge.
Le média c'est pas ma tasse de thé donc j'ai laissé tomber.

Essai d'installer NOOBS ou Raspbmc ou Raspbian avec le package xbmc (le conseil de JeanLuc).

Une install ne coûte que le temps de charger la carte SD et avec plusieurs de comparer.

JumpZero
Posts: 1131
Joined: Thu Mar 28, 2013 7:35 pm
Location: 127.0.0.1

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 12:42 pm

Bjr,
Putty est en place, par contre comprendre quelle ligne taper pour avoir une liste des taches en cours c'est une autre paire de manche.
la commande est = top
comme on le voit dans la video dont Toons a donné le lien.
La tu verras tes process en cours, celui qui consomme le + de cpu en haut, la page est rafrichie toutes les 5 (environ) secondes.
Il y aussi plein d'autres informations utiles, usage memoire, temps total utilé par chaque process, etc..
Comme toutes les commandes GNU/Linux celle ci vient avec son manuel. Pour voir le manuel d'une commande on tape: man nom_de_la_commande. Donc si tu fais man top, tu verras tout ce que tu peux faire avec top.
--
Jmp0
EDIT= taper q pour quitter top, mais c'est evident non?

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 1:34 pm

ok merci. j'avais pas saisi la simplicité, je cherchai un soft qui s'appelait "top" sur le net, et le manuel qui s'y colle, j'ai donc trouvé une page où il expliquait tout le langage, les syntaxes, espaces, tirets... bref un sacré bordel à comprendre et apprendre pour juste une commande !
donc là j'ai pigé, MERCI !!
je suis aussi en train d'installer raspbian après avoir testé raspbmc où mon cpu n'indiquait absolument rien ce coup ci, même pas 0% ou 1%, la barre restait figée à vide, la mémoire indique 10% et rien d'autres, ça ramait quand même bien moins mais je trouve l'interface graphique vraiment pas pratique, toujours pas de contrôle de volume dans le lecteur de musique !! aberration quand tu nous tiens...
je vais tester un bon vieux VLC en espérant qu'il s'en sorte avec si peu de ressources, je vous tiens au jus.
Encore merci pour vos conseils et leur traduction ;)
omR.

JumpZero
Posts: 1131
Joined: Thu Mar 28, 2013 7:35 pm
Location: 127.0.0.1

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 2:12 pm

Hi!
je cherchai un soft qui s'appelait "top" sur le net,
Reflex windowsien :lol:
GNU/Linux comme tous les *nix est livré complet avec plein d'utilitaires, d'accessoires et toujours la doc!
En plus d'être libre et gratuit. Ça change la vie, hein. :D
La plupart du temps la solution au problème est déjà dans le système. Mais c'est vrai qu'il faut énormément lire, mais heureusement il y a Google. Raspbian est basé sur Debian et il y a cet excellent bouquin http://debian-handbook.info/
--
Jmp0

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 3:05 pm

yéyéyéééééhh ! j'adore linux
même pas besoin de télécharger VLC, je tape une ligne en mode console distante et hop ça se fait tout seul ;) j'y crois pas encore, j'suis sous le choc là...
bon c pas encore gagné, la moindre vidéo de 1Mo fait tout planter en plein écran et impossible de fermer vlc faut que je me déconnecte. Je pense que ma route est encore longue avant d'avoir un ptit pc tout simple pour lire vidéos et mp3, j'en demande pas plus mais là, il en chie.

Voilà ce que me dit "top" et ça fait bien 10 minutes que j'y touche plus... :
Image
Une manip évidente à faire ? un truc magique ? genre désactiver je ne sais quoi je ne sais où ?? je suis tout ouï !

déjà est ce que c possible d'avoir Raspbian + VLC sur mon Raspberry 512Mo - 700MHz et de lire des vidéos et mp3 sur serveur NAS et que le tout marche et soit fluide ? je demande pas de la rapidité de ninja non plus, juste opérationnel quoi...
a+, omR.

ToOnS
Posts: 492
Joined: Sat Mar 23, 2013 10:29 am

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 4:26 pm

de memoire (j'ai Alzheimer) VLC (celui de debian , donc celui qu'on telecharge par default) est pas optimisé du tout pour utiliser les accelerations materielles de RPI , du coup c'est le processeur qui fait tout et la puce video se la cool douce , donc ca rame. Il me semble avoir vu une version speciale de VLC pour le RPI avec les accelerations materielles mais je sais plus trop ou , le probleme d'internet c'est que c'est assez grand.
peu etre que c'etait cette version http://www.mrvestek.com/hosted/vlc_hw_raspberry.rar ? (maintenant que t'es a l'aise avec la commande "top" tu pourras voir si celui la utilise moins de "cpu")
si DougieLawson passe par la il pourra confirmer ou pas , il me semble qu'il avait suivi ca

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 5:43 pm

j'ai trouvé ce tuto: http://intensecode.blogspot.fr/2013/10/ ... ation.html

ptin j'me régale avec la console, ça enchaîne, finis les plantages de routine, ça me manque...

je saisis pas tout ce que je fais mais en suivant les tutos ça a l'air de fonctionner. J'ai fait un "remove" vlc et en parallèle je suis le tuto.
je tiens au jus ou je crierai à l'aide...

encore merci de m'avoir ouvert les yeux ;) omR.

JumpZero
Posts: 1131
Joined: Thu Mar 28, 2013 7:35 pm
Location: 127.0.0.1

Re: CPU à 100% en permanence avec seulement XBMC de base...

Mon Jan 20, 2014 6:31 pm

Bonsoir,
Très bien que des bonnes nouvelles. Ce tuto c'est du lourd puisque tu compiles les sources de VLC. A moins que tu télécharge la version déjà compilée qu'il propose au bas de la page.
Je m’intéresse assez peu au multimédia mais pour regarder des films quand je suis a l’hôtel j'ai une carte SD avec raspbmc et c'est génial ça marche tout seul. La SD dans le pi, la TV en hdmi sur le pi et ça roule. Il y a une petite image de carte SD pour raspbmc ensuite au premier boot il charge la suite, ensuite des qu'une MaJ sort il l'installe. Mais vraiment rien a faire, très simple. Tu peux déclarer des lecteurs réseau, je l'ai fait mais avec 2 ou 3 films seulement dans le dossier, je n'ai pas vu de lenteur, mais avec un gros NAS plein de films je ne sais pas. Enfin je te dis ça, mais VLC sur raspberry c'est surement excellent aussi. Autrement de base installé avec Raspbian, il y a omxplayer. Avec GNU/Linux toujours plein de choix.
--
Jmp0

Brescio
Posts: 1
Joined: Thu Jan 23, 2014 6:47 pm

Re: CPU à 100% en permanence avec seulement XBMC de base...

Thu Jan 23, 2014 7:07 pm

Mon expérience de novice :

Personnellement j'utilise Openelec pour faire la même chose que toi. Sur le rpi sont connectés 1 clef wi-fi (suffisant pour les mp3 et divX mais un peu light pour la HD quant il s'agi d'aller chercher tout ça sur mon nas) et un disque dur qui possède sa propre alimentation (un disque alimenté par l'usb n'est dans mon cas pas possible à cause d'une alim sans doute faiblarde).

Le system est dans mon cas installé sur une carte sd de classe 10. Ta clef usb est peut être la source du problème pour 2 raisons :
- les 2 ports usb sont (il me semble) qu'1 vrai port avec 2 branchements (à confirmer) ==> les 2 périphériques branchés en usb se partagent la bande passante du port ==> ralentissement (j'insiste, ça reste à confirmer mais je sais que c'est fréquent sur pas mal de systems)
- Ta clef usb est lente (comme beaucoup de clefs). Vu que tout le system (swap compris) se trouve sur cette clef, ça peu peut être venir de la.

Pour lire correctement n'importe quel film en HD, j'ai overclocké mon rpi (850Mhz) on trouve pas mal de tuto très bien faits pour les novices (comme moi) sur le net. J'avais constaté que mes films subissaient des ralentissements au delà d'environ 10Go le film. Aujourd'hui je peux lire des films de 30Go (mais toujours pas les iso de dvd).

Les seuls véritables ralentissement que j'ai, c'est quand je met à jour la bibliothèque : impossible de faire quoi que ce soit d'autre de façon fluide/supportable.

Autre point : j'ai fait une installation basique d'openelec et je n'ai rien installé d'autre. Mon rpi me sert actuellement exclusivement de HTPC.

Enfin, dernier point : 1 port usb pris par la clef wifi, l'autre pris par un HDD, je n'ai donc rien pour la télécommande. J'utilise donc soit mon smartphone, soit la télécommande de ma TV (hdmi cec).

omrlepsykotist
Posts: 9
Joined: Sun Jan 19, 2014 10:29 am
Location: gap
Contact: Website

Re: CPU à 100% en permanence avec seulement XBMC de base...

Thu Jan 23, 2014 7:31 pm

Salut, et merci beaucoup pour ton retour d'expérience.
Après avoir constater les ralentissements j'avais abandonné la solution swap sur clé USB et le soucis restait le même avec openelec ou raspbmc sur une 4Go classe 4, gros lagg en permanence, et ce même après une journée à rester allumé en ayant actualiser la bib sur mon NAS en RJ45 (pas de wifi pour moi), je retesterai certainement à un moment.
Pour le moment j'ai installé carrément Raspbian, il s'allume bien, curseur bien fluide, l'interface graphique est bien plus jolie que les openelec ou raspbmc à mon goût, résolution "normale" et nette.
Mon soucis maintenant est de faire tourner VLC en version raspberry, j'ai fait les 15000 manip décrite sur un tuto, en vain... j'a télécharger un VLC spécial raspberry (lien dans une réponse précédente à ce même topic) mais je ne sais pas comment complètement virer l'ancien et ou mettre le répertoire VLC téléchargé.
C 2-3 derniers jours et les prochains je suis sur d'autres trucs donc c en standby mais je suis preneur de conseils tuto etc pour installer ce vlc ou simplement utiliser omxplayer (introuvable bien qu'apparemment inclus dans le raspbian).
voilà où j'en suis de mon avancée, je tiens au jus.

reste cette p****n d'aberration de ne pas avoir de contrôle de volume sur openelec ou raspbmc en lecture musique, ça me paraît impossible de ne pas avoir d'autres solutions que le CEC en HDMI, quelqu'un est au point là dessus ?

bien A+ ;)
omR.

Return to “Français”